| void vtkVector2< T >::Set | ( | const T & | x, |
| const T & | y | ||
| ) | [inline] |
Set the x and y components of the vector.
Definition at line 163 of file vtkVector.h.
| void vtkVector2< T >::SetX | ( | const T & | x | ) | [inline] |
Set the x component of the vector, i.e. element 0.
Definition at line 171 of file vtkVector.h.
| const T& vtkVector2< T >::GetX | ( | ) | const [inline] |
Get the x component of the vector, i.e. element 0.
Definition at line 174 of file vtkVector.h.
| void vtkVector2< T >::SetY | ( | const T & | y | ) | [inline] |
Set the y component of the vector, i.e. element 1.
Definition at line 177 of file vtkVector.h.
| const T& vtkVector2< T >::GetY | ( | ) | const [inline] |
Get the y component of the vector, i.e. element 1.
Definition at line 180 of file vtkVector.h.
| const T & vtkVector2< T >::X | ( | ) | const |
Legacy method for getting the x component.
